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of retainers, in particular to a nut retainer structure which comprises a cover plate, a tooth-shaped ring and a sealing frame, and the cover plate is arranged outside the tooth-shaped ring in a sleeved mode. The sealing frame is provided with a plurality of ball pockets used for fixing steel balls, the tracks of the ball pockets are spirally distributed on the annular circumferential wall of the sealing frame, one steel ball is arranged in each ball pocket in a rolling mode, the two axial ends of the sealing frame are each connected with a tooth-shaped ring in an inserted mode, and at least one part of the sealing frame penetrates through the tooth-shaped rings and is connected to the cover plate in an inserted mode. According to the utility model, the retainer structure is improved, so that the use of circulating parts is avoided, the noise is greatly reduced, the installation difficulty is reduced, and the lubricating property and the machinability are improved.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of retainers, in particular to a nut retainer structure. Background Art

[0002] Ball screws are ideal for converting rotary motion into linear motion, or vice versa. Ball screws typically consist of a nut, a lead screw shaft, and steel balls. The nut and lead screw shaft come into direct contact with each other during movement, leading to collisions and noise during high-speed, cyclic operation.

[0003] To avoid the above situation, the existing technology mainly realizes the staggered arrangement of the steel balls by setting a retaining block between two adjacent steel balls. In order to ensure that the ball screw can continue to move during use, it is also necessary to cooperate with the circulation structure to realize the circulation of the steel balls. The popular circulation methods on the market are mainly internal circulation, external circulation and end circulation. For the above circulation methods, they all rely on ball returners or circulation bends to make the steel balls circulate in the bends to realize the circulation of the steel balls. However, the circulation structure is difficult to design and has high processing requirements. In order to achieve the coordination between the circulation structure, steel balls and retaining blocks, the development difficulty is increased to a certain extent, and the installation difficulty is relatively high, which is inconvenient to install and disassemble. Utility Model Content

[0004] The technical problem to be solved by the present invention is: in order to solve the technical problems that the existing retainer still needs to use a circulation structure after installation, which is easy to generate noise, has high design difficulty, high processing requirements, and is inconvenient for disassembly and assembly, the present invention provides a nut retainer structure. By improving the retainer structure, the use of circulation components is avoided, the noise is greatly reduced, the installation difficulty is reduced, and the lubrication performance and machinability are improved.

[0005] The technical solution adopted by the utility model to solve the technical problem is: a nut retainer structure, comprising:

[0006] cover;

[0007] A toothed ring, wherein the cover plate is sleeved on the outside of the toothed ring;

[0008] A sealing frame is provided with a plurality of ball pocket holes for fixing steel balls, the trajectories of the plurality of ball pocket holes are spirally arranged on the annular circumferential wall of the sealing frame, a steel ball is rolled in each ball pocket hole, a toothed ring is respectively inserted at both axial ends of the sealing frame, and at least a portion of the sealing frame passes through the toothed ring and is inserted on the cover plate.

[0009] Therefore, the steel ball is fixed by setting a sealing frame, and the trajectory of the ball pocket hole used to fix the steel ball is spirally arranged, which plays a role similar to the internal thread of the nut to facilitate the rotation of the steel ball, thereby converting the rotational motion of the screw shaft into the linear motion of the nut, and the circulation mode is also changed to the self-rotation of the steel ball, avoiding the use of the circulation structure and the adverse conditions that are prone to occur when the steel ball contacts the circulation structure. The overall structure is simpler to operate, reducing the difficulty of processing and installation, and removing the circulation structure also reduces noise in operation to a certain extent; the axial ends of the sealing frame are inserted into the toothed ring to fix the sealing frame axially and circumferentially, and a cover plate is sleeved on the outside of the toothed ring to further fix the toothed ring axially. At least a part of the sealing frame passes through the toothed ring and is inserted into the cover plate, so that the sealing frame is circumferentially fixed relative to the cover plate.

[0010] Furthermore, the sealing frame includes a plurality of retaining frames arranged in a ring array with a gap between adjacent retaining frames, and both axial ends of each retaining frame are plugged into the toothed ring, thereby fixing the sealing ring axially and circumferentially.

[0011] Furthermore, one of the retaining frames is provided with an extended end at each of its axial ends, and the extended end passes through the toothed ring and is plugged into the cover plate, thereby achieving circumferential fixation between the sealing frame and the cover plate.

[0012] Furthermore, the outer circumference of the toothed ring is provided with a plurality of latching teeth, and a slot is formed between two adjacent latching teeth, and each retainer is inserted into one of the slots. Thus, the retainer and the toothed ring are prevented from rotating by inserting the retainer into the slot, thereby forming a circumferential limit for the retainer.

[0013] Furthermore, each retainer is provided with a plug connector at each axial end, which is plugged into the plug slot, and the extended end passes through the plug slot and is then plugged into the cover plate. Thus, the circumferential ends of the plug slot abut against the circumferential ends of the plug connector, thereby forming an anti-rotation feature between the retainer and the toothed ring, forming a circumferential limit for the retainer, and thus ensuring the stability and performance of the sealing frame.

[0014] Furthermore, the plug connector includes a first portion and a second portion, the first portion and the second portion being perpendicularly connected to form an "L"-shaped structure. The first portion is inserted into the plug slot, with the circumferential ends of the plug slot corresponding to the circumferential ends of the first portion, and the second portion abuts against the end face of the toothed ring facing the seal frame. Thus, the circumferential ends of the first portion abut against the circumferential ends of the plug slot to form a circumferential limit for the retainer, and the second portion abuts against the end face of the toothed ring facing the seal frame to form an axial limit for the retainer.

[0015] Furthermore, each retainer has multiple arcuate grooves formed axially on both sides, with the corresponding arcuate grooves on two adjacent retainers forming a ball pocket. Thus, the concave design of the arcuate grooves better positions and secures the steel balls, reduces noise generation, and prevents the balls from falling out during actual operation. Furthermore, the arcuate grooves also serve to store lubricating oil, improving the product's lubrication performance during actual use.

[0016] Furthermore, the cover plate is provided with a groove, and the toothed ring is arranged in the groove. Thus, the toothed ring is placed in the groove, which plays a role in limiting the axial and radial directions of the toothed ring.

[0017] Furthermore, the groove includes a bottom portion and a sidewall portion. The end face of the geared ring, facing away from the seal holder, abuts against the bottom portion, while the sidewall portion sleeves over the outer circumference of the geared ring. Thus, the bottom portion axially limits the geared ring, while the sidewall portion radially limits the geared ring, ensuring that the seal holder does not move axially during operation and maintaining the required coaxiality among the seal holder, geared ring, and cover plate.

[0018] Furthermore, the cover plate is provided with a mounting hole, which is axially arranged from the end surface of the cover plate, thereby achieving axial fixation between the cover plate and the end surface of the nut through the mounting hole.

[0019] Furthermore, the cover plate is provided with an engagement hole, which is arranged axially from the end surface of the cover plate. At least a portion of the seal frame extends through the toothed ring and is inserted into the engagement hole. Thus, the engagement hole provides axial positioning between the cover plate and the seal frame. When the cover plate and the nut are axially secured, the axial securing force can be transmitted to the portion of the cover plate and the seal frame that is engaged.

[0037] like Figures 1 to 7 As shown, it is the optimal embodiment of the present utility model. A nut retainer structure of this embodiment includes: a cover plate 1, a toothed ring 2 and a sealing frame 3. The cover plate 1 is sleeved on the outside of the toothed ring 2; the sealing frame 3 is provided with a plurality of ball pocket holes 301 for fixing steel balls, and the trajectories of the plurality of ball pocket holes 301 are spirally arranged on the annular circumferential wall of the sealing frame 3. A steel ball is rolled in each ball pocket hole 301. A toothed ring 2 is respectively inserted at both axial ends of the sealing frame 3. At least a portion of the sealing frame 3 passes through the toothed ring 2 and is inserted on the cover plate 1.

[0038] Therefore, the steel ball is fixed by setting the ball pocket hole 301 on the sealing frame 3, avoiding mutual squeezing and wear between the steel balls, and reducing working noise. The trajectory of the ball pocket hole 301 used to fix the steel ball is arranged in a spiral manner, which plays a role similar to the internal thread of the nut, so as to facilitate the rotation of the steel ball, thereby converting the rotational motion of the screw shaft into the linear motion of the nut, and the circulation mode is also changed to the self-rotation of the steel ball, avoiding the use of the circulation structure, and avoiding the adverse conditions that are prone to occur when the steel ball contacts the circulation structure. The overall structure is simpler to operate, reducing the difficulty of processing and installation, and removing the circulation structure also reduces noise in operation to a certain extent; the axial ends of the sealing frame 3 are inserted into the toothed ring 2 to fix the sealing frame 3 axially and circumferentially, and a cover plate 1 is sleeved on the outside of the toothed ring 2 to further fix the toothed ring 2 axially. At least a portion of the sealing frame 3 passes through the toothed ring 2 and is inserted into the cover plate 1, so that the sealing frame 3 is circumferentially fixed relative to the cover plate 1.

[0039] In this embodiment, the cover plate 1 is an integrated structure.

[0040] In this embodiment, the toothed ring 2 is an integrated structure.

[0041] In this embodiment, the sealing frame 3 includes a plurality of retaining frames 302 arranged in a ring-shaped array with gaps between adjacent retaining frames 302. Both axial ends of each retaining frame 302 are plugged into a toothed ring 2. Thus, the sealing ring is fixed axially and circumferentially.

[0042] In this embodiment, one of the retaining frames 302 is provided with an extended end 303 at both axial ends, and the extended end 303 passes through the toothed ring 2 and is plugged into the cover plate 1. Thus, the sealing frame 3 and the cover plate 1 are circumferentially fixed.

[0043] In this embodiment, the outer circumference of the toothed ring 2 is provided with a plurality of latching teeth 201. An insertion slot 202 is formed between two adjacent latching teeth 201. Each retainer 302 is inserted into an insertion slot 202. Thus, the engagement of the retainer 302 with the insertion slot 202 prevents rotation between the retainer 302 and the toothed ring 2, thereby providing circumferential positioning for the retainer 302.

[0044] In this embodiment, the plurality of latch teeth 201 are arranged in a ring array.

[0045] In this embodiment, each retainer 302 is provided with a plug connector 304 at each axial end. The plug connector 304 is inserted into the insertion slot 202, and the circumferential ends of the insertion slot 202 abut against the circumferential ends of the plug connector 304. Thus, by abutting the circumferential ends of the insertion slot 202 against the circumferential ends of the plug connector 304, an anti-rotation mechanism is formed between the retainer 302 and the geared ring 2, forming a circumferential limit for the retainer 302, thereby ensuring the stability and performance of the sealing frame 3.

[0046] In this embodiment, the plug connector 304 comprises a first portion 3041 and a second portion 3042, which are vertically connected. The plug connector 304 has an L-shaped structure. The first portion 3041 mates with the insertion groove 202, with the circumferential ends of the insertion groove 202 correspondingly abutting the circumferential ends of the first portion 3041. The second portion 3042 abuts the end surface of the geared ring 2 facing the seal frame 3. Thus, the circumferential ends of the first portion 3041 abut against the circumferential ends of the insertion groove 202, thereby circumferentially limiting the retainer 302. The second portion 3042 abuts against the end surface of the geared ring 2 facing the seal frame 3, thereby limiting the retainer 302 in the axial direction.

[0047] In this embodiment, a plurality of arcuate grooves 3011 are axially defined on both sides of each retainer 302. The corresponding arcuate grooves 3011 on two adjacent retainers 302 form a ball pocket 301. Thus, the concave design of the arcuate grooves 3011 better positions and secures the steel balls, reduces noise generation, and prevents the steel balls from falling out during actual operation. Furthermore, the arcuate grooves 3011 also serve to store lubricating oil, improving the product's lubrication performance during actual use.

[0048] In this embodiment, a groove 101 is formed on the cover plate 1, and the toothed ring 2 is disposed in the groove 101. Thus, the toothed ring 2 is placed in the groove 101, which serves to limit the toothed ring 2 in the axial and radial directions.

[0049] In this embodiment, groove 101 includes a bottom portion 1011 and a sidewall portion 1012. The end surface of geared ring 2, facing away from seal holder 3, abuts against bottom portion 1011, while sidewall portion 1012 sleeves over the outer circumference of geared ring 2. Thus, bottom portion 1011 axially limits geared ring 2, while sidewall portion 1012 radially limits geared ring 2, ensuring that seal holder 3 does not move axially during operation and maintaining the required coaxiality among seal holder 3, geared ring 2, and cover plate 1.

[0050] In this embodiment, a mounting hole 102 is formed on the cover plate 1 and is axially arranged from the end surface of the cover plate 1. Thus, the cover plate 1 and the end surface of the nut are axially fixed through the mounting hole 102.

[0051] In this embodiment, the cover plate 1 is provided with an engagement hole 103, which is arranged axially from the end surface of the cover plate 1. At least a portion of the seal holder 3 extends through the toothed ring 2 and is inserted into the engagement hole 103. Thus, the engagement hole 103 provides axial restraint between the cover plate 1 and the seal holder 3. When the cover plate 1 and the nut are axially secured, the axial securing force can be transmitted to the portion of the cover plate 1 and the seal holder 3 that are engaged.

[0052] Specifically, the assembly steps of this embodiment are as follows: first, the plug connectors 304 at both axial ends of each retaining frame 302 are inserted into a plug-in groove 202, so that the sealing frame 3 is arranged in a ring shape; then, a steel ball is installed in each ball pocket hole 301, so that the arrangement trajectory of the steel ball on the sealing frame 3 is a spiral structure; finally, the toothed ring 2 is installed in the groove 101 on the cover plate 1, and the extended end 303 of the retaining frame 302 is inserted into the fitting hole 103 of the cover plate 1 after passing through the plug-in groove 202; the nut retainer is assembled after the above steps, and the nut retainer is arranged inside the nut, and the nut retainer is axially fixed to the end face of the nut through the mounting hole 102, and then the nut retainer is sleeved on the screw shaft so that the spherical surface of the steel ball contacts the internal thread groove of the nut and the external thread groove of the screw shaft.

[0053] In summary, the unique design of the sealing frame 3 of the present invention avoids the use of a circulation structure, the overall structure is simpler to operate, and the processing difficulty and installation difficulty are reduced. In terms of processing, the requirements for the mold are reduced, the mold opening cost is saved, and the processing efficiency is improved. In terms of design, the circulation mode is changed to the self-rotation mode of the steel ball, and the concave design of the arc-shaped groove 3011 can better position and fix the steel ball, reduce the noise generation, and ensure that the steel ball will not fall off during actual operation. The design of the arc-shaped groove 3011 can also serve as a storage oil, thereby improving the lubrication performance of the product in actual use. In terms of connection mode, the plug-in mode between the retaining frame 302 and the toothed ring 2, and the installation mode between the toothed ring 2 and the cover plate 1, realize axial, axial and radial limiting, so that the retainer as a whole becomes a detachable integrated structure, which is easy to disassemble and assemble, and reduces the difficulty of installation.
